999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

網絡流媒體技術的研究

2009-03-30 04:52:54劉淑平賀同輝
新媒體研究 2009年3期
關鍵詞:多媒體

劉淑平 賀同輝

[摘要]互聯網的產生使得網絡流媒體技術與我們的生活息息相關。對流式傳輸的特點、流媒體系統的組成進行介紹,并重點闡述流式傳輸協議。

[關鍵詞]流媒體啟動延時RTP

中圖分類號:TP3文獻標識碼:A文章編號:1671-7597(2009)0210134-01

自互聯網產生以來,受網絡帶寬的限制,互聯網上的信息都以文字、圖片等靜態數據為主,而音頻、視頻數據則難以在網上發布。隨著ADSL、視迅寬帶、FDDI網的出現,網絡帶寬得到很大的改善,可以達到100M以上的傳輸速率,但仍無法滿足高質量的多媒體信息傳輸的需要,這就要從數據的傳輸方式上著手來解決問題。由此,流媒體技術應運而生。

一、流媒體技術概述

流媒體(streaming)技術是指在發送端和接收端之間以獨立于網絡負載的以給定速率傳輸音頻、視頻信息的一種傳輸技術。流媒體具有隱含的時間維、傳輸的實時性和等時性、高吞吐量等特點。目前因特網由于存在帶寬不足、服務質量控制機制較弱等局限性,難以滿足流媒體的實時性要求,為此因特網工程任務組(IETF)制定了一系列支持流媒體實時傳輸和服務質量控制的協議,如RTP、RSVP、RTCP等。其中,RTP是所有這些協議的基礎。在網絡上傳輸音頻或視頻等多媒體信息,目前主要有下載回放和流式傳輸兩種方案。流媒體技術是一種使用流式傳輸連續的時基媒體的技術。流式傳輸方式是將視頻、音頻等其他媒體壓縮為一個個壓縮包,由視頻服務器向用戶計算機連續、實時傳送,只需要在用戶端緩存足夠可播放的視頻容量就可以開始播放。

二、流媒體系統的組成

1.編碼工具。即用于創建、捕捉和編輯多媒體數據,形成流媒體格式。利用媒體采集設備進行流媒體的制作。它包括了一系列的工具,從獨立的視頻、聲音、圖片、文字組合到制作豐富的流媒體。這些工具產生的流媒體文件可以存儲為固定的格式,供發布服務器使用。

2.流媒體數據。即媒體信息的載體。常用流媒體數據格式有.ASF、RM等。

3.服務器。即存放媒體數據。由于要存儲大容量的影視資料,因此該系統必須配備大容量的磁盤陣列,具有高性能的數據讀寫能力,可以高速傳輸外界請求數據并具有高度的可擴展性、兼容性,支持標準的接口。這種系統配置能滿足上千小時的視頻數據存儲,實現片源的海量存儲。

4.網絡。即適合多媒體傳輸協議甚至是實時傳輸協議的網絡。流媒體技術是隨著互聯網絡技術的發展而發展起來,它在現有互聯網絡的基礎上增加了多媒體服務平臺。

5.播放器。即供用戶欣賞網上媒體的軟件。流式媒體系紡支持實時音頻和視頻直播和點播,可以嵌入到流行的瀏覽器中,可播放多種流行的媒體格式,支持流媒體中的多種媒體形式,如文本、圖片、Web頁面、音頻和視頻等集成表現形式。目前應用最多的播放器有美國Real Networks公司的Real Player、美國微軟公司的Media Player、美國蘋果公司的Quicktime三種產品。

目前,Real System被認為是在窄帶網上最優秀的流媒體傳輸系統,其允許的帶寬限制從28.8kbps的撥號上網到10M的局域網,允許點播的人數從100流到1000流甚至無限流。Real System系統由三部分組成:(1)媒體內容制作工具Real Producer。主要是用于壓縮制作多媒體內容文件,實時壓制現場信號并傳送給Real Server進行現場直播;也可以把其他音頻、視頻和動畫等多媒體文件格式轉換成Real Server支持并進行流媒體廣播的Real格式。(2)服務器引擎Real Server。它是目前國際上最強力的因特網和Intranet上的流傳播服務引擎,利用該服務引擎用戶可以在客戶端無須等待數據全部下載完畢即可實時收看直播節目。(3)客戶端播放軟件Real Player。用來向服務器發出請求,接收并回放從Real Server傳送的媒體節目。

三、流式傳輸協議

1.RSVP(資源預留協議)。該協議促使流數據的接收者主動請求數據流路徑上的路由器,并為該數據流保留一定的資源(即帶寬),從而保證一定的服務質量。RSVP是一個在IP上承載的信令協議,它允許路由器網絡任何一端上終端系統或主機在彼此之間建立保留帶寬路徑,為網絡上的數據傳輸預定和保證服務質量。

(1)RSVP協議中涉及到發送者和接收者的概念,這兩個概念是在邏輯上進行區分的。發送者指發送路徑消息的進程,而接收者是指發送預留消息的進程,同一個進程可以同時發送這兩種消息,因此既可以是發送者也可以是接收者。

(2)資源預留的分類。專用預留:它所要求的預留資源只用于一個發送者,即在同一會話中的不同發送者分別占用不同的預留資源。共享預留:它所要求的預留資源用于一個或多個發送者,即在同一會話中的多個發送者共享預留資源。

(3)RSVP提供兩種發送者選擇方式。通配符方式:默認所有發送者,并通過預留消息中所攜帶的源端地址列表來限制通配符濾波器。顯式指定方式:濾波器明確指定一個或多個發送者來進行預留。

2.RTP(實時傳輸協議)。用于Internet上針對多媒體數據流的傳輸。RTP協議為數據提供了具有實時特征的端對端傳送服務,如在組播或單播網絡服務下的交互式視頻音頻或模擬數據。應用程序通常在UDP上運行RTP以便使用其多路結點和校驗服務。RTP可以與其他適合的底層網絡或傳輸協議一起使用。如果底層網絡提供組播方式,那么RTP可以使用該組播表傳輸數據到多個目的地。

3.RTCP(實時傳輸控制協議)。實現通過客戶端對服務器上的音視頻流做播放、錄制等操作請求。該協議通過RTSP協議實現了在客戶端應用程序中對流式多媒體內容的播放、暫停、快進、錄制和定位等操作。RTP和RTCP一起提供流量控制和擁塞控制服務。

4.RTSP(實時流協議)。建立并控制一個或幾個時間同步的連續流媒體,如音頻和視頻。盡管連續媒體流與控制流交叉是可能的,但RTSP本身并不發送連續流,換言之,RTSP充當多媒體服務器的網絡遠程控制。RTSP提供了一個可擴展框架,實現實時數據(如音頻與視頻)的受控、按需傳送。數據源包括實況數據與存儲的剪輯。RTSP用于控制多個數據發送會話,提供了選擇發送通道(如UDP、組播UDP與TCP等)的方式,并提供了選擇基于PRTP的發送機制的方法。

總之,隨著流媒體技術的不斷發展以及網民對流媒體的需求的增加,流媒體技術將會日臻成熟并穩步發展。

猜你喜歡
多媒體
借助多媒體探尋有效設問的“四度”
巧用多媒體 學生樂識字
甘肅教育(2020年21期)2020-04-13 08:09:26
移動云計算中多媒體工作流的節能計算卸載
電子制作(2019年22期)2020-01-14 03:16:28
多媒體在初中化學教學中的運用
時代人物(2019年29期)2019-11-25 01:35:20
多媒體在《機械制圖》課中的應用
消費導刊(2018年10期)2018-08-20 02:56:28
初中化學因多媒體而綻放光彩
基于Android 多媒體管理系統的研究
巧用多媒體 讓課堂練筆更加有效
中小學電教(2016年3期)2016-03-01 03:40:51
多媒體達人煉成記
河南電力(2016年5期)2016-02-06 02:11:40
提高高中數學多媒體課件質量的幾點思考
主站蜘蛛池模板: 国产精品福利尤物youwu| 亚洲综合激情另类专区| 国产自产视频一区二区三区| 精品国产中文一级毛片在线看 | 亚洲另类第一页| 无码不卡的中文字幕视频| 一级不卡毛片| 国产欧美日韩精品综合在线| 亚洲男人天堂久久| 国产成人精品午夜视频'| 亚洲免费三区| 亚洲综合天堂网| a级毛片免费网站| 久久夜色精品国产嚕嚕亚洲av| 亚洲久悠悠色悠在线播放| 中文字幕1区2区| 91色国产在线| 日本一区高清| 亚洲天堂免费在线视频| 久久综合亚洲色一区二区三区| 四虎国产在线观看| 日韩国产黄色网站| 久久国产乱子| 欧洲亚洲一区| 亚洲一区二区约美女探花| 狼友视频一区二区三区| 久久黄色小视频| 中文字幕波多野不卡一区| 免费观看三级毛片| 国产日韩欧美在线视频免费观看| 欧美伦理一区| 91在线视频福利| 久久国产精品麻豆系列| 国产无码精品在线播放 | 国产99免费视频| 欧美亚洲一二三区| 亚洲综合18p| 欧美中出一区二区| 92午夜福利影院一区二区三区| 久久男人资源站| 不卡午夜视频| 免费va国产在线观看| 国产清纯在线一区二区WWW| 亚洲欧美自拍视频| 国产打屁股免费区网站| 国产激情第一页| 亚洲有无码中文网| 国产人人射| 99九九成人免费视频精品| 高潮爽到爆的喷水女主播视频 | 亚洲色图在线观看| 国产va在线| 国产青榴视频| 亚洲精品动漫| 亚洲免费人成影院| 亚洲人成网站在线播放2019| 亚洲色偷偷偷鲁综合| 国产精品亚欧美一区二区三区| 国产v欧美v日韩v综合精品| 国产成人精品免费av| 黄色一级视频欧美| 亚欧美国产综合| 久久免费成人| 日本高清在线看免费观看| A级全黄试看30分钟小视频| 素人激情视频福利| 欧美一级在线播放| 免费a在线观看播放| 99视频有精品视频免费观看| 91精品啪在线观看国产| 91免费国产在线观看尤物| 亚洲伊人天堂| 免费在线不卡视频| 国产精欧美一区二区三区| 亚洲最大福利视频网| 国产SUV精品一区二区| 亚洲无码免费黄色网址| 欧美区国产区| 伊大人香蕉久久网欧美| 999福利激情视频| 国产日韩欧美视频| 欧美成人一级|